Votes at a glance: Ada County Board approves multiple routine items, tables one procurement award

Ada County Board of County Commissioners · November 26, 2025

Summary

At its Nov. 21 meeting the Ada County Board approved a package of routine business: removal of an agenda item, approvals of a homeowner variance, three resolutions (3147, 3148, 3149), a proclamation supporting America250, multiple agreements (including an intergovernmental agreement with the City of Eagle to collect impact fees), tax cancellations and claims; it tabled award of the courthouse handrail contract to Dec. 2.

Summary of formal actions taken by the Ada County Board of Commissioners on Nov. 21:

- Motion to remove agreement number 15535-1-25 from the agenda — approved by voice vote. - Motion to remove unfinished business from the table and consider application 202501820 — approved; variance for Dan Sessions (application 202501820) approved. - Resolution 3147 — conveyance of HAVIS vehicle keyboards to Franklin County Sheriff’s Office — approved. - Resolution 3148 — sole-source procurement for Caron compactor wheels for the landfill — approved. - Resolution 3149 — update to Development Services fee schedule — approved. - Proclamation endorsing America250 in Idaho and county event plan — approved. - Bid opening for Courthouse exterior handrail replacement (Bid 26007): two bids opened ($250,000 and $580,000); board tabled award and directed staff to return Dec. 2, 2025 for award consideration. - Approval of catering permits, license transfers and new licenses as listed on the agenda — approved. - Authorization of payment of claims on claims journal dated 11/21/2025 — approved. - Approval of tax cancellations/adjustments associated with homestead exemptions filed after the roll closed — approved. - Agreements package (10 agreements) including intergovernmental agreement with the City of Eagle for collection/expenditure of development impact fees for jail and coroner purposes — approved. - Agreement 31190 (EMS intergovernmental agreement with City of Eagle) — approved while board sat as the EMS district.

Most items were approved by voice vote; where bids were opened the board deferred award pending staff review. For each approved action, staff were instructed to carry out routine follow-up tasks such as filing final documents, processing cancellations, or returning with procurement recommendations.
